Subject: Change of ownership — connection pooling

Team, effective Monday, responsibility for the Fernhollow database connection pool configuration moves off my plate. On-call: pool sizing, timeout tuning, and leak investigations should no longer be routed to me. All escalations and pages for pooling issues now go to the new owner named below.

account owner for fajep-yagef: Kasix Eliiel

The Thumbcask thumbnail generation queue ships as a single container plus a worker pool. Plugins submit render jobs over the local socket; the queue handles fan-out, deduplication, and retries. For production, run at least two workers and mount the cache volume read-write — thumbnails are content-addressed, so a shared cache is safe across replicas. Plugin authors should not assume ordering; jobs may complete out of submission order. Health probes are exposed on the admin port. A reference production configuration is provided below.

settings of tagef-bawif:
DRUIX_HOST=druix.zemvarlabs.internal
DRUIX_PORT=8000

## Runbook: Gaugepile Sidecar — Release Checklist

Heads up: the sidecar ships with every app pod, so a bad config fans out fast. Before cutting a release, confirm the flush interval hasn't drifted from what the Tallyhouse aggregator expects, or you'll see sawtooth gaps in dashboards. Rollbacks are cheap — just repin the image tag. Canary one node pool first, watch for ten minutes, then proceed. The values to verify against are these.

config for bagep-yafof:
quenath:
  pin: 8584
  metrics_host: metrics.quenath.tolvaqsys.internal
  tenant: pelath
  seal: seal_ed102645

- [ ] Show the new starter the spare-hardware storage room on Level 2 of the Maplewright Annex. Walk them through the sign-out ledger, point out the shelf labels, and confirm the door closes fully behind you. Before leaving, make sure they note the pass code for the keypad, which is as follows.

door code, yagap-bahof: bdg-O-05

Ticket: The Saltmere health-check configuration vault is locked, blocking external plugin authors from publishing probe definitions. Checks behind the Driftwell load balancer currently fall back to TCP-only, so plugin-level readiness signals are being ignored and unhealthy instances may receive traffic. We have verified the vault contents are intact; only the seal needs to be lifted. The recovery passphrase to unseal the vault is below.

recovery phrase for tawig-kahag: olimir-praath